The aesthetically appealing CoolSpot II offers incredibly pure, white light along with a guaranteed no-drift arm, high intensity setting and variable spot size control. The Coolspot II offers intensity of up to 13,000 footcandles at 24" and 5000 footcandles at 1 meter. The Coolspot II Minor Surgery Light is the spotlight of choice.

Burton's new AIM-50 provides both amazing illumination, unparalleled aesthetics and many more features that make it the right light for any procedure.With a Color Rendering Index (CRI) of 96, 45,000 Lux at 36 inches, and a color temperature of 3100° Kelvin, the AIM-50 enhances your vision by allowing a true rendition of colors. This light is ideal for long hours of use with three cool 50-watt quartz halogen bulbs – each rated with a 2000-hour average bulb life.
The AIM-50’s 360° limitless arm-and-mounting-system-rotation around vertical axes on single ceiling models (a feature previously available only on O.R. type lights) makes it the right light for outpatient procedures in a variety of settings and practices such as: trauma centers, emergency rooms, ambulatory surgery centers, intensive care units, physician offices, clinics, plastic surgery, dermatology, and ophthalmology.
